Transaction 57b331bd4fd305fbd3ed6a4f7ff640a858e2ce331b17b1e5f42fa375fc532109
1 Input
1 Output
-
57b331bd4fd305fbd3ed6a4f7ff640a858e2ce331b17b1e5f42fa375fc532109:0
- value
- 1199301
- script pubkey
- OP_0 OP_PUSHBYTES_20 ddc1c795a6ac220c4bcc8bfd4d46652bc2be8e6b
- address
- bc1qmhqu09dx4s3qcj7v307563n990ptarnt6t0n70